Self-funded plans: an insurance arrangement in which the employer assumes direct financial responsibility for the costs of enrollees’ medical claims. Employers sponsoring self-funded plans typically contract with a third-party administrator or insurer to provide administrative services for the self-funded plan. In some cases, the employer may buy stoploss coverage from an insurer to protect the employer against very large claims.

U.S. workers with self-funded insurance and stoploss coverage in 2025, by firm size
According to the data, among all self-funded firms, 75 percent had stoploss coverage in 2025. Self-funded plans are those in which the employer assumes direct financial responsibility for the costs of enrollees’ medical claims rather than purchasing health insurance for them. Stoploss coverage is used to limit the firm's liability for very large claims or an unexpected level of expenses. Generally, the larger the company, the more it is able to spread the risk of costly claims over a large number of workers and dependents and therefore has less need for stoploss coverage.
